Flying High Nursery School provides high-quality childcare for children aged 3 months to 4 years across two Birmingham locations in Ward End and Castle Bromwich. Established in 2017, the nursery is committed to offering a safe and stimulating environment where children can learn and grow.
They prioritise strong partnerships with parents and the local community, ensuring a collaborative approach to early education. The settings boast fantastic outdoor spaces for exploration, private parking for convenience, and robust security measures including CCTV and secure entry systems.
A dedicated, highly qualified, and experienced team of staff delivers a personalised learning journey for each child. The nursery also features excellent kitchen facilities, providing healthy meals and snacks with Halal and vegetarian options.
Parent feedback consistently highlights high satisfaction, with 100% of parents agreeing their child enjoys nursery and makes good progress, and all would recommend the nursery to others. They emphasise a five-star promise comprising well-qualified staff, beautiful facilities, a nurturing environment, personalised learning, and a strong foundation for early education.

Inclusion & environment
Staff work closely with parents to identify any children with special educational needs and/or disabilities and those who may benefit from additional support. There are secure systems in place to ensure referrals to any external agencies and professionals are made swiftly, to obtain the support and intervention needed. Staff tailor the environment and activities to ensure these children benefit from what is on offer and make progress overtime. Children with speech and language delay and those who speak English as an additional language are supported through targeted intervention.
